   <subfield code="a">The supplier selection problem (SSP) is a complex decision making process due to the different parameters and various aspects needed to be considered before decisions are made. Hence, a group approach approach to SSP is encouraged especially that stakeholder approach, and inter-firm trusts and cultural considerations in supplier selection are increasingly becoming important. a group approach in decision making normally produces better or more desirable results. This is possibly because groups have collective knowledge than individuals. However, a group approach in SSP is bounded by the issues  of uncertainties/ impreciseness, inconsistencies, disagreements/non-consensus, incomplete preference information and preference maximization which are important to consider. Recognizing the importance of proper supplier selection, there is a need to develop group decision making methodology for supplier selection that maximizes consistency, consensus and preferences of supplier evaluators, and recognizes the degree of impreciseness and incompleteness of the supplier evaluators' preference information. The study proposed a stochastic  Analytic Hierarchy Process-based methodology that provides linear programming model that does not only maximize consistency and consensus but also the preference of the supplier evaluators, and provides a reward-penalty system for preciseness/impreciseness and completeness/incompleteness of supplier evaluators' preference information. The proposed methodology was applied to actual business setting and then tested with secondary data. Results of the comparison experiments conducted favor the proposed methodology.</subfield>
